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Age between 18 – 50 irrespective of sex, religion and occupation. Patients complaining of dull luster, open pores, pigmentation, Needs complexion. Individuals having normal, tan, dull skin, acne marks, black heads and white heads. People with dry skin and wrinkles. Patients willing to participate.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Age below 18 years Patients with systemic and metabolic disorders. Patients with hyperpigmentation, birth marks and severe acne. Pregnant and lactating mothers
